Splatter Art

 

View Create at Home Activities

 

 

Art is sometimes most fun when mess is involved! Create your own chalk-paint splatter art masterpiece with a few household ingredients. Inspired by Jackson Pollock, we got creative with the tools we used to paint.

 

Supplies

  • ½ cup cornstarch
  • 2/3 cup water
  • Food coloring
  • Large bowl for mixing
  • Fork for mixing
  • Individual cups or muffin tin for paint
  • Smock or clothes to get messy in
  • Paintbrush
  • Spoon
  • Anything around your house that could create a good splatter!
    • Fun Fact: Jackson Pollock would paint with sticks, trowels, and by pouring paint directly from the can

 

 

How-To

 

 

Steps

  1. Combine water and cornstarch in your bowl, mix with fork until smooth
  2. Add 2-3 drops of food coloring to each empty cup
  3. Pour equal amounts of the cornstarch/water mix into each cup, stir until food coloring is mixed in
  4. Bring your paint and painting tools outside; use your paintbrush and other utensils to drip, flick, splash, and splatter your chalk-paint on your driveway or sidewalk
